Wade opens with win in Wolverhampton

JAMES WADE won his opening match in Group H at the 2009 PartyPoker.com Grand Slam of Darts with a 5-3 triumph over Gary Mawson.

Wade struggled throughout in an under-par performance but managed to come out on top, and will now play Robert Thornton on Monday evening.

The world number three held throw at the start of the match despite Mawson having four opportunities to break.

Mawson won the second leg and had more chances to win the third, but the American was guilty of missing more doubles and Wade took a 2-1 lead.

Wade, who became Premier League champion back in May, broke his opponent's throw for a 3-1 lead, and then landed double 16 for a 4-1 advantage.

Wade missed three darts for the match in the sixth leg and Mawson stepped in by hitting double seven to keep his hopes alive.

Wade missed two more chances to close the game out in the next leg and Mawson hit double top to reduce the deficit to 4-3.

In the eighth leg Mawson missed one dart at double top to take the game into a deciding leg, and Wade pounced by converting a 102 checkout to get the two points.
